Luna Modeler 是一款专注于数据库设计与管理的专业工具,旨在为用户提供直观、高效的数据库建模体验。它支持多种主流数据库系统,包括关系型与 NoSQL 数据库,适用于开发人员、数据分析师和数据库管理员。该工具采用现代化的界面设计,与系统深度集成,确保流畅的操作体验。通过可视化的实体关系图(ERD)设计,用户可以轻松创建、修改和管理复杂的数据结构,并自动生成规范的 SQL 脚本。同时,Luna Modeler 强调协作功能,支持团队实时同步和版本控制,大幅提升数据库开发效率。
软件截图
安装流程
打开安装包将软件图标
拖拽至右侧Applications
文件夹完成安装
功能特色
-
多数据库支持:兼容 MySQL、PostgreSQL、SQL Server、Oracle 以及 MongoDB 等主流数据库,提供统一的建模与管理界面,减少切换工具的繁琐操作。
-
智能逆向工程:可从现有数据库自动生成 ER 图,快速解析表结构、关系和约束,帮助用户理解或优化复杂数据库架构。
-
可视化设计工具:通过拖拽式界面创建表、字段、索引和外键,实时预览 ER 图布局,支持自动对齐与美化功能,提升可读性。
-
SQL 脚本生成与同步:根据模型一键生成符合规范的 DDL 脚本,支持双向同步,确保设计与实际数据库结构一致。
-
团队协作与版本控制:集成 Git 或其他版本控制系统,支持多人同时编辑模型,冲突检测与合并功能减少协作中的错误风险。
-
高性能与优化:针对大型数据库模型进行性能优化,即使处理数百张表仍保持流畅响应,支持分模块设计以降低复杂度。
-
跨平台导出与分享:支持导出为 PDF、PNG 或交互式 HTML 文档,便于与团队成员或客户共享设计方案。